RE: Harmy's STAR WARS Despecialized Edition HD

It's a matter of evidence. As you said, no one can know 100%--not even George Lucas and the DPs of the films. So you have to go external.

There is ample evidence to indicate the bolder colour choices are what the film looked like.

What is there backing up the muted colour? The GOUT? What else? We know the GOUT is desaturated, so that rules that out. In the end, we have a couple of odd 1980s home video releases that have a slew or problems, like being bright, soft, colour-shifted, etc., because they are 1980s analog home video sources. So if you want to go with this colour scheme--what is your reasoning?

It seems more and more like it's purely personal preference. Which is fine.

I have said it before: my favourite transfer of the GOUT is the 2010 Editdroid, which is the most muted and therefore least accurate transfer to date. But it looks the most pleasing, in part because the GOUT has a lot of colour popping problems. Just like the 2004 SE. But I realise its not what the film should look like.

RE: Harmy's STAR WARS Despecialized Edition HD

That's what I was trying to say about Harmy's shots in comparison to the Technicolor caps. There's a red bias in Harmy's original shot comparison not seen in the Technicolor print and that is what makes faces look so occasionally odd (look at R2's red light, Luke's face, etc. like I said before) so it's not just a matter of saturation but color timing, so even if you're going to have it be oversaturated you can still have the fleshtones look more natural.

RE: Harmy's STAR WARS Despecialized Edition HD

OK, I'm at the lightsabre duel and it is a bigger mess than you could possibly imagine. I'm not sure I'll be able to do much about it, even Ady couldn't (I'm actually using his AVCHD version for the duel, because he at least fixed some of the lightsabre colours). But both Obi's and Vader's LS still keep changing shades and Obi's tunic keeps changing colour ranging from red over brown to outright black and when I try correcting it, it just fucks up everything else, so I'll just try to kind of smooth the changes over and leave it at that.
